WebMay 17, 2024 · Marine Corps Scholarships Foundation. The Marine Corps Scholarships Foundation makes scholarships of up to $30,000 available to the dependents of veterans of the U.S. Marine Corps, including disabled veterans. To be eligible, an applicant must have a family income of $86,000, or less, and must have a grade point average of at least 2.0. WebWoman’s Army Corps Veterans’ Association Scholarship. Free tuition and fee waivers are available to eligible family members of armed forces veterans in Wisconsin. The Wisconsin GI Bill provides that the spouse and unmarried children aged 18 to 25 may apply.
